Sep.12 (GMM) Cadillac is ramping up preparations for its 2026 Method 1 entry, having staged a full-scale ‘shadow race weekend’ ultimately week’s Italian GP at Monza.
In keeping with Italy’s Autosprint, the American outfit mirrored each facet of the grand prix from its Charlotte and Silverstone bases, with engineers, strategists and media employees operating by the weekend as if Cadillac was already on the grid.
The train concerned round 50 folks, with the ‘digital automotive’ up to date session by session in simulators after which analysed in technical debriefs. Technique groups rehearsed variable eventualities equivalent to tyre administration, security vehicles and climate modifications, whereas reliability conferences simulated checks on the ability unit and transmission.
“It wasn’t simply an educational train – the aim was to duplicate the complexity of a race weekend in each element,” reported journalist Ilaria Toscano.
Cadillac, led by bosses Dan Towriss and Graeme Lowdon, who had been each at Monza, reportedly first trialled this system in the course of the Spanish GP in Barcelona earlier this yr.
The scheme additionally contains mock media duties for the drivers – to be Valtteri Bottas and Sergio Perez subsequent yr – designed to assist rookies and veterans steadiness interviews, sponsor commitments and technical briefings.
Software program improvement is one other profit, with knowledge from the simulations feeding predictive algorithms that Cadillac hopes will sharpen its race methods by the point of its official debut in Melbourne 2026.
